We are building an Archimedes Screw Pump and measuring the number of turns required to move a specified amount of fluid from a lower reservoir to an upper reservoir. We want to know if the procedure portion of our Research Plan should include step-by-step details of how to construct the screw pump or if it is ok to just give a general description of how we built it and save the step-by-step detail for the actual experiment?
